Right here lies the Promenade Éric Tabarly a tribute to a great sailor. It is located in the 19th arrondissement of Paris. The Promenade Éric Tabarly stretches along the Quai de la Loire. This vibrant area sits in the Quartier de la Villette.

Éric Tabarly was a famous French Navy officer. He was also an innovative sailor. Tabarly competed in the world’s most prestigious sailing races. He sadly disappeared at sea off the coast of Ireland in 1998. He was sailing his boat Pen Duick.

The Promenade Éric Tabarly got its name in 2008. It runs along the Bassin de la Villette. The promenade extends between numbers 31 and 39 on Quai de la Loire.

Across the basin, you will see Promenade Florence Arthaud. This promenade is near the marina. The Bassin de la Villette is the largest artificial body of water in Paris. It links the Canal de l’Ourcq to the Canal Saint-Martin. Napoléon I inaugurated it on December 2, 1808. Initially, it supplied water to the population. It also aided river transit of goods.

The Promenade Éric Tabarly provides a pleasant place to stroll. You can enjoy the water and the surrounding area. The Quai de la Loire is a hub of activity. People enjoy walking, fishing, and playing pétanque here.

During the warmer months, the area comes alive. You can find entertainment like open-air performances. Lively guinguettes offer food and drink. Restaurants also line the banks. There are play areas for children.
